11: PCR and Electrophoresis

Students extract DNA, perform initial and nested PCR amplification of the GAPDH gene, run gel electrophoresis to separate DNA fragments, and interpret band patterns.

Gel Migration Problem

DNA Marker # of
Base Pairs
(bp)
Migration
Distance
(cm)
500 base pairs 500 3.31
1,000 base pairs 1000 3.05
2,000 base pairs 2000 2.79
3,000 base pairs 3000 2.64
5,000 base pairs 5000 2.45
10,000 base pairs 10000 2.19
Unknown ? ? 2.73

The standard DNA ladder and unknown DNA strand listed in the table were separated using an agarose gel
Estimate the number of base pairs of the unknown DNA strand.
Note: answers need to be within 11% of the correct number to be correct.
